    古希腊的佛里几亚国葛第士以非常巧妙的方法,在战车的轭(è)上打了一串结。他预言:谁能打开这个结,就可以征服亚洲。一直到公元前334年,还没有一个人能够成功的将绳结打开。这时,亚历山大入侵小亚西亚,他来到葛第士绳结之前,便拔剑砍断了绳结。后来,他果然一举占领了比希腊大50倍的波斯帝国。

    一个孩子在大山里割草,被毒蛇咬伤了脚。孩子疼痛难忍,而医院在远处的小镇上。孩子毫不犹豫地用镰刀割断受伤的脚趾,然后,忍着疼痛保住了自己的生命。

    一位朋友到一家餐馆应征做钟点工。老板问:“在人群密集的餐厅里,如果你发现手上的托盘不稳,即将跌落,该怎么办?”许多应聘者都答非所问,朋友答道:“如果四周都是客人,我就要尽力把托盘倒向自己。”最后,朋友成功了。

    亚历山大果断地用剑砍绳结,说明他舍弃了传统的思维方式;小孩果断地舍弃脚趾,以短痛换取了生命;服务员果断地把即将倾倒的托盘投向自己,才保证了顾客的利益。在某个特定的时候,你只有敢于舍弃,才有机会获得更长远的利益。即使遭到难以避免的挫折,你也要选择最佳的失败方式。

    成功往往蕴涵于取舍之间。不少人看似素质很高,但他们往往难以舍弃眼前的蝇头小利,而忽视了更长远的目标。成功者有时仅仅抓住了一两次被别人忽视了的机遇,而机遇的获取,关键在于你是否能在人生道路上进行果断的取舍。
